Pakistan vs Slovenia: UN Voting Alignment
How often do Pakistan and Slovenia vote the same way at the UN General Assembly? Agreement over every shared roll-call vote since 1946, by year, decade, and topic — plus the resolutions where they split.
Overall agreement
48.8%
of 2,413 shared UN General Assembly votes since 1946

Agreement by topic
| Topic | Agreement | Shared votes |
|---|---|---|
| Israel–Palestine | 74.3% | 510 |
| Nuclear weapons | 29.3% | 441 |
| Disarmament | 42.3% | 575 |
| Colonialism | 63.7% | 331 |
| Human rights | 31.6% | 563 |
| Economic development | 58.5% | 241 |

Frequently asked questions
How often do Pakistan and Slovenia vote together at the UN?
Pakistan and Slovenia voted the same way in 48.8% of 2,413 shared UN General Assembly votes since 1946.
Do Pakistan and Slovenia agree on human rights votes?
On human rights resolutions, Pakistan and Slovenia mostly disagree: they voted the same way in 31.6% of 563 shared human-rights votes at the UN General Assembly.
